Transaction 69594feae7802726a53b8c497335fa8d0550816be154b5a13cf14c9cbff52171
1 Input
1 Output
-
69594feae7802726a53b8c497335fa8d0550816be154b5a13cf14c9cbff52171: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 e2e6bd3fed9eabdba855cee8af8f09e2e641e85c10984ae991b8cd03ec4de9db
- address
- bc1putnt60ldn64ah2z4em52lrcfutnyr6zuzzvy46v3hrxs8mzda8dsr8mrll